Variant summary
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_018708.3(FEM1A):āc.1025C>Gā(p.Pro342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000154 in 1,612,286 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/20 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Nov 24, 2024 | The c.1025C>G (p.P342R) alteration is located in exon 1 (coding exon 1) of the FEM1A gene. This alteration results from a C to G substitution at nucleotide position 1025, causing the proline (P) at amino acid position 342 to be replaced by an arginine (R).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
